Hello everyone,

ftp.suse.com/pub/people/mason/data-logging

has beta code that gives you the following:

external logging devices
data logging mount option (makes fsync and O_SYNC faster)
ordered data mount option (no more garbage in your files after a crash)

optimizations to keep kupdate from triggering commits every 5 seconds
optimizations for tiny transactions to reduce CPU usage and IO.
optimizations for better locking and fewer calls to wakeup()

In short, it adds a bunch of features and makes everything faster.  The
changes are very large, but they also build on older patches that have
been circulating around for months.  It has been through a weekend of
load testing here, but I still won't be surprised if people find
corruption causing bugs.

It needs broad testing and benchmarking, in all the data modes, with a
standard and external journal.

-chris
